About the project

Random Is My Favourite Colour is a Canadian LGBTQ documentary that delves into the life and past of artist Lyle XOX. As Lyle prepares to release his first ever book at Bergdorf-Goodman will he be able to let go of his past to move into a loving future.

The film is directed by Stuart Gillies (Shut Up And Say Something, 2017 and Literally, 2018), and produced by Sebastien Galina and Geoff Manton for BOLDLY.
